From: Circ_0015756 promotes the progression of ovarian cancer by regulating miR-942-5p/CUL4B pathway

Fig. 5

CUL4B is a target of miR-942-5p. a The predicted binding site between miR-942-5p and CUL4B 3′UTR was shown. The binding relationship between miR-942-5p and CUL4B 3′UTR was confirmed by dual-luciferase reporter assay (b, c) and RIP assay (d, e). f, g The mRNA and protein levels of CUL4B were measured in OV90 and SKOV3 cells transfected with miR-NC, miR-942-5p, anti-miR-NC or anti-miR-942-5p. h, i The mRNA and protein levels of CUL4B were examined in OC tissues and normal tissues. j, k The expression of CUL4B in IOSE80, OV90 and SKOV3 cells was determined by qRT-PCR and Western blot. *P < 0.05
